Did you know?
WebThe Chinese were among the first to immigrate to the United States during the California gold rush and today are the largest population (23%) of Asian Americans. Early immigrants from China were largely male laborers, and immigration was curtailed by anti-Chinese laws beginning in the late 1880s. WebCensus 2024: Every Chinese counts!
